iOS的编程语言概况-的特点解析-Swift语法更简洁、易学性能更高还引入了许多新特性
一、iOS的编程语言概况
iPhone应用开发主要用到的编程语言是Objective-C和Swift。Objective-C是一种老牌语言,而Swift则是苹果在2014年推出的新语言,目的是取代Objective-C。
二、Swift的特点解析
Swift语言简洁、现代,使用起来非常方便。它不仅继承了Objective-C的功能,还加入了很多新特性,比如闭包、泛型等,使得代码更加安全、稳定。
三、Objective-C的重要性
尽管Swift很流行,但Objective-C在iOS开发中依然很重要。很多老项目都是用Objective-C编写的,因此开发者需要了解这门语言。
四、编程语言的选择
选择哪种语言取决于项目需求和开发者熟悉程度。如果需要与Objective-C代码库协同工作,Objective-C是更好的选择;对于新项目,Swift通常更受欢迎。
五、未来趋势
Swift在苹果的推动下越来越受欢迎,未来很可能会成为iOS开发的主流语言。开发者应该保持学习,掌握新的编程语言和工具。
相关问答FAQs
1. iOS使用的主要编程语言是什么?
主要使用的编程语言是Swift和Objective-C。
2. Swift和Objective-C之间有什么区别?
Swift语法更简洁、易学,性能更高,还引入了许多新特性。
3. 我是否需要学习Objective-C才能进行iOS开发?
对于新手来说,学习Swift即可。Objective-C对于维护老项目有帮助,但不是必须的。